Practice Tips
To make the most of this lesson, employ the shadowing technique as you engage with the video material. Start by playing short segments of the video, focusing initially on the first few phrases. Listen carefully to how the speaker articulates their words; notice their intonation and rhythm. Then, pause the video and repeat the phrases aloud to practice shadowspeech.
As you become more comfortable, increase the length of the segments you practice. Aim to mimic not just the words, but the emotions and emphasis used by the speaker. If the video feels too fast at times, slow it down using playback settings without losing the natural flow of speech. This will help you gradually improve your English pronunciation and fluency.
Remember to integrate these practices into your daily routine. Regular exposure to native speakers will enable you to fine-tune your listening skills and increase your vocabulary—two crucial components for success in IELTS speaking practice. With dedication and effort, you will notice significant improvements in your speaking abilities over time.
What is the Shadowing Technique?
Shadowing is a science-backed language learning technique originally developed for professional interpreter training and popularized by polyglot Dr. Alexander Arguelles. The method is simple but powerful: you listen to native English audio and immediately repeat it out loud — like a shadow following the speaker with just a 1–2 second delay. Unlike passive listening or grammar drills, shadowing forces your brain and mouth muscles to simultaneously process and reproduce real speech patterns. Research shows it significantly improves pronunciation accuracy, intonation, rhythm, connected speech, listening comprehension, and speaking fluency — making it one of the most effective methods for IELTS Speaking preparation and real-world English communication.
